Scouts clear alien vegetation in local nature reserve

On June 15 members of the 1st Bedfordview Scout Troop spent 10 hours clearing invading alien vegetation from the Bill Stewart Nature Reserve.

This conservation project was organised by Mr Michael Omand, patrol leader for Sable Patrol, as part of his First Class Advancement Badge.

Ward councillor Jill Humphreys visited the Scouts as they cleared a grove of Australian Blue Gums and was thrilled to see the youngsters getting involved in the conservation of the nature reserve.
